The Lebanese junior golf team achieved impressive results at the Al Ain tournament in the United Arab Emirates, part of the Asian League series (JAGA), with the participation of 60 players representing 21 countries worldwide. Here are the technical results of the Lebanese delegation:

– U18 Category:

First Place: Miroas Arghandiol

– U15 Category:

First Place: Lara Bakhour

– U13 Category (Boys):

Second Place: Milan Chekry

– U13 Category (Girls):

Third Place: Yasmin Al-Husseini (the youngest player in the tournament at 9 years old).

Karim Salim Salam, the president of the Lebanese Golf Federation, expressed his pride and appreciation for the team’s performance, which showcased a strong image of Lebanon, highlighting the abilities of its athletes to secure valuable victories despite difficult circumstances and challenges. He also expressed his gratitude to the parents who accompanied their children to the tournament to support and encourage them, as is customary in most international tournaments.

Salam also praised the organizing efforts of the tournament and commended their hospitality. The tournament was hosted by the United Arab Emirates Golf Federation.

It is worth mentioning that the JAGA Asian tour series will continue until April 2025, with various stages taking place in 25 Asian countries.
